Transaction ec0025726b856250d418acc14850a2d5aaaf775a6d20d9fbb97453e8372e918e
1 Input
1 Output
-
ec0025726b856250d418acc14850a2d5aaaf775a6d20d9fbb97453e8372e918e:0
- value
- 1628471
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5cae42f62146a36e67435ab854cc21b0816faed4 OP_EQUAL
- address
- 3A94r6eWPedCKRDst3eq4G2CCMzyQPdCH9